We went to
La Sebastiana, one of the Neruda’s houses. I’m not a big fan of Neruda,
actually I hate him, but I like to visit cultural places. La Sebastiana is like
all of his houses. It has a lot of weird things –Neruda was very strange-, most
of them related to the sea. The bad thing about it is that is hard to get
there. You need to take a bus and the trip takes half an hour or more.
We ate sea
food. I like sea food, specially fish. We went to El Mercado of Valparaíso – I
didn’t translate it as “market” because obviously is more than a market, you
can eat Chilean food there and buy fresh vegetables-. I ate fried merluza and
rice. We had mote con huesillo then. Once we finished a musician started to
play for us.
